I am trying to run automated tests (Selenium) of out web application, and every time it opens a FF window it gets blocked by a popup saying "Would you like to help improve Mozilla FF etc)". I have tried clicking No and restarting FF, and also un-checking Submit Performance Data in Options. Please let me know what I need to do, as I can't continue with the task I'm meant to be doing until I can fix this! Thanks...

You can set the Boolean pref toolkit.telemetry.prompted to true on the about:config page or use the file user.js to initialize that pref to true.

I tried to set toolkit.telemetry.prompted to true, but still it is asking every time while opening a browser window from selenium.

If selenium doesn't use that profile, but creates a new profile or initialize that profile in another way then it won't work.

Is that pref still set?

If a new profile is created then try to initialize that pref via a user.js file in the default template folder "\defaults\profile" (you need to create that folder in the Firefox program folder).


user_pref("toolkit.telemetry.prompted", true);

Try this: create a file called user.js in your profile with the following 3 lines:

user_pref("toolkit.telemetry.enabled", false); user_pref("toolkit.telemetry.prompted", 2); user_pref("toolkit.telemetry.rejected", true);

https://support.mozilla.com/en-US/questions/898549

The prefs as posted by davidtse916 apply to Firefox 9+ versions and not Firefox 7/8 where toolkit.telemetry.prompted is a Boolean pref.

FWIW, profile creation with toolkit.telemetry.prompted has been added in newer versions of selenium (not sure exactly, some version after 2.3).
